Harry Hill is the headline act in the May show from Bearcat Viaduct.

The event has been rearranged to the second Friday of the month due to the Hanwell Hootie and now takes place on 13 May starting at 8pm.

As well as the former host of TV Burp and You’ve Been Framed, comedians Mark Maier, Alasdair Beckett-King, Eric McElroy and Jacqui Doherty will be appearing.

Tickets can be bought online for £15 including booking fee. The event is selling out fast but there was still availability at the time of writing.

A meal deal is offered in which the first 20 people to show eTickets at the bar between 6pm and 7pm will pay £15 for a two course meal.

The Viaduct is now fully open and boast a new French chef and Courtyard Garden as well as the refurbished existing garden. The New Stable Bar can be hired for a small family or business event.

The Viaduct is at 221 Uxbridge Road (W7 3TD).
